Bronx, N.Y. – The Lehman College softball team dropped both games of its CUNYAC Doubleheader against visiting John Jay College, by scores of 12-2 and 9-0, respectively, at South Field on Monday. The Lightning fall to 8-10 overall record and 6-8 in CUNYAC action, while the Bloodhounds improve to 11-17 mark and 8-6 in conference play.
In the opener, Lehman took a 2-0 lead after the first inning of play, however John Jay scored one in the second, three in the third to take a 4-2 advantage. Then the Bloodhounds crossed the plate three more times in the fifth inning and five in the sixth for the victory.
Samantha Nazar had an RBI double and scored a run for the Lightning, while
Michelle Frias also drove in a run off a single, while
Lizbeth Perez went one-for-two with a run scored.
In the nightcap, Lehman held John Jay off the scoreboard for two innings before surrendering nine runs in the next three innings. The highlight for the Lightning was Nazar as her single in the bottom of the fourth ended the Bloodhounds' no hitter.
Lehman continues CUNYAC action on Wednesday when it travels to take on Hunter College in a twin-bill at Randall's Island with the first pitch set for 3 pm ET.
